Product Description

Heavy diesel locomotive Vossloh G 2000 BB with symmetrical driver's cab, as Am 840 of the Swiss Federal Railways (SBB), used for the goods sector SBB Cargo. Fire red/ultramarine blue basic color with basalt gray frame. Locomotive operating number Am 840 002-0. Operating state of the era VI.With digital decoder mfx+ and extensive sound and lighting functions. Regulated high-performance motor with rotor installed centrally. All 4 axles powered by cardan shafts. Traction tyres. Alternating three-light headlight signal dependent on direction of travel and 2 red tail lights conventional in operation and digitally controlled. Spike signal at loco-side 2 and 1 each can switched separately digitally. If the spike signal is off at both the loco-sides, then double-sided function of the dual A-light. Lighting of driver's cab per driver's cab is digitally switchable separately. Lighting with maintenance-free warm white and red light emitting diodes (LED). Many separately applied details. Longitudinal rails on the frame made of metal. Detailed buffer beam. Pluggable brake hoses are included. The enclosed front covers can also be mounted on the headstock. Length over buffer 20 cm.You will find this model in DC version in the TRIX H0 assortment under article number 22881.This text is machine translated.
